HOME-STYLE CHICKEN & CHEESY GARLIC SAUCE WITH CREAMY MASH & VEGGIES
Pair chicken breast strips with our Aussie spice blend and you've got a match made in heaven. With a creamy cheese and garlicky sauce wanting to join in on the fun, we just couldn't say no. More is more in our books, and you'll love us for it!
Provided by HelloFresh
Categories main course
Time 35m
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- Bring a medium saucepan of lightly salted water to the boil. Peel the potato and cut into 2cm chunks. Add the potato to the boiling water and cook until easily pierced with a knife, 10-15 minutes. Drain and return to the saucepan. Add the butter (for the mash), milk and the salt, then mash with a potato masher or fork until smooth. Cover to keep warm.
- While the potato is cooking, cut the broccoli into small florets and roughly chop the stalk. Thinly slice the carrot (unpeeled) into half-moons. Finely chop the garlic (or use a garlic press). Finely chop the parsley leaves. In a medium bowl, combine the Aussie spice blend, a drizzle of olive oil and season with pepper. Add the chicken breast strips and toss to coat.
- Heat a large frying pan over a high heat. Add the broccoli, carrot and a generous splash of water and cover with a lid or foil. Cook until softened, 5-6 minutes. Remove the lid, then add 1/2 the garlic and cook, stirring, until fragrant, 1 minute. Season with salt and pepper. Transfer to a bowl and cover to keep warm.
- Return the frying pan to a medium-high heat with a drizzle of olive oil. When the oil is hot, add 1/2 the chicken and cook, turning, until browned and cooked through, 3-4 minutes. Transfer to a plate and repeat with the remaining chicken. TIP: Chicken is cooked through when it's no longer pink inside.
- Wipe out the frying pan and return to a medium heat. Add the butter (for the sauce) and the remaining garlic and cook until fragrant, 30 seconds. Add the longlife cream (see ingredients list), grated Parmesan cheese, parsley and any chicken resting juices. Season with pepper and stir to combine. Reduce the heat to low and simmer until thickened slightly, 2-3 minutes.
- Divide the mashed potato, veggies and homestyle chicken strips between plates. Pour the cheesy garlic sauce over the chicken.

CREAMY GARLIC CHICKEN
Serve up creamy garlic chicken with fluffy mashed potato and spinach for a comforting family dinner. This simple and satisfying recipe is the perfect midweek meal
Provided by Georgina Kiely - Digital food editor, bbcgoodfood.com
Time 50m
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Cook the potatoes in boiling salted water for 20-25 mins until tender when pierced with a knife. Meanwhile, heat the 2 tbsp Flora Buttery in a frying pan over a medium heat until melted, then fry the onion for 10 mins until softened. Stir in the garlic, fry for a minute more, then add the chicken and fry for 5 mins until lightly golden.
- Pour in the wine, bring to a simmer and reduce until halved. Stir in 250ml of the crème fraîche. Cook for 5 mins until the chicken is cooked through, and the sauce has thickened slightly.
- Drain the potatoes, leave to steam dry for 1 min, then mash with the 50g Flora Buttery, remaining crème fraîche and some seasoning, until smooth. Stir the herbs and spinach through the chicken and cook for a minute or so until the spinach wilts. Add the lemon juice and some seasoning. Serve spooned over the creamy mash.

PAN-BRAISED CHICKEN WITH VEGETABLES IN BALSAMIC-CREAM SAUCE
Lovely flavors of the Mediterranean combine in this main dish recipe to serve over mashed potatoes or pasta. Onion, mushrooms, garlic, fresh tomatoes, fresh spinach, cream, and a touch of balsamic vinegar really dress up boneless, skinless chicken thighs, in about an hour.
Provided by Bibi
Categories Meat and Poultry Recipes Chicken Chicken Breast Recipes Pan-Fried
Time 1h
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- Spread chicken thighs on a clean work surface. Pat dry with paper towels and season both sides with salt and pepper. Sprinkle 1/2 of the Italian seasoning all over them.
- Heat oil in a 12-inch nonstick skillet over medium-high heat. Add chicken thighs and brown for 3 minutes per side. Remove chicken to a plate and keep warm.
- Add onions to the same skillet and stir up any browned bits from the bottom of the pan. Cook, stirring occasionally, until onions just start to become tender, 3 to 5 minutes. Add mushrooms and cook until they begin to soften, about 4 minutes. Stir in garlic and remaining Italian seasoning. Taste and adjust salt and pepper. Cook and stir for 1 minute.
- Add chicken broth and return chicken thighs to the skillet. Reduce heat to low, cover, and cook until chicken juices run clear, about 15 minutes. An instant-read thermometer should read 165 degrees F (74 degrees C). Remove chicken to a cutting board and cut into bite-sized pieces.
- Return chicken to the skillet and increase heat to medium. Add tomatoes and spinach. Cook and stir until tomatoes are heated through and spinach is tender, but still bright green, about 3 minutes.
- Stir in 1/2 cup heavy cream and balsamic vinegar; bring to a gentle boil. Cook and stir for 3 minutes. If you prefer a creamier sauce, add more cream. Serve with shaved Parmesan cheese.
